netkiller-BG7NYT
https://netkiller.blog.csdn.net
展开
-
FreeSWITCH 1.10 最新版 Rocky Linux / AlmiLinux 安装
点击自己头像,选择“Personal Access Tokens” 进入个人访问令牌页面,然后点击“+ Add New” 创建令牌。Token Name 处输入令牌名称,然后点击 “Generate Token” 生成令牌。PERSONAL ACCESS TOKEN 下面一串字符,就是令牌,请复制出来并保存好。安装 compat-openssl10。安装 freeswitch。启动 freeswitch。原创 2025-04-07 08:15:00 · 827 阅读 · 0 评论 -
freeswitch 基本配置
X-PRE-PROCESS cmd="stun-set" data="external_rtp_ip=autonat:你的公网IP地址"/>前面的基本配置,是物理服务器网卡直接配置公网IP地址,很多云主机采用弹性IP机制,将公网IP映射到云主机上。这种模式就需要用到 NAT。<X-PRE-PROCESS cmd="stun-set" data="external_rtp_ip=IP地址"/>fail2ban 自动拦截恶意注册。修改默认密码,将 1234 改为。这是我的配置仅供参考。原创 2025-04-07 09:00:00 · 952 阅读 · 0 评论 -
FreeSWITCH 1.10 最新版 MySQL 配置
FreeSWITCH 1.10 最新版 MySQL 配置。原创 2025-04-08 08:00:00 · 629 阅读 · 0 评论 -
FreeSWITCH 1.10 最新版,网关配置
通常在 /etc/freeswitch/vars.xml 中配置,在 internal.xml 和 external.xml 中通过变量引用。默认是 :: 表示 ipv6 localhost,如果需要远程访问可以改为 listen-ip 0.0.0.0。参考 /etc/freeswitch/sip_profiles/external/example.xml 文件。NAT 配置 172.16.0.10 替换成公网 IP 地址。原创 2025-04-08 09:30:00 · 1389 阅读 · 0 评论 -
FreeSWITCH 测试号码
账号密码在 /etc/freeswitch/vars.xml 配置文件中。9197 milliwatte extension,铃音生成。33xx 电话会议,48K(其中xx可为00-99,下同)5000 示例IVR4000听取语音信箱。9195 echo,回音测试,延迟5秒。9198 TGML 铃音生成示例。1000-1019 测试账号位置。9196 echo,回音测试。32xx 电话会议,32K。31xx 电话会议,16K。2000-2002 呼叫组。30xx 电话会议,8K。输入密码,并进入客户端。原创 2025-04-09 08:00:00 · 909 阅读 · 0 评论 -
Linksys/PAP2T-5.1.6(LS) 登录 freeSWITCH 和 asterisk 失败
使用 Yate / Kamailio / OpenSIPS 作为 SIP 服务器,Linksys 能正常登录,拨打IP电话。差异是 Kamailio 采用 Authorization 方案,而 freeSWITCH 采用 WWW-Authenticate 方案。对比 Kamailio 与 freeSWITCH 包的差异,最终发现问题处在认证头。使用 ngrep 抓包,经过分析,问题处在认证登录头。freeSWITCH 抓包。Kamailio 抓包。原创 2025-04-09 08:30:00 · 1747 阅读 · 0 评论 -
creating a WebSphere Commerce instance
测试tnsnames.ora。原创 2025-04-04 08:00:00 · 482 阅读 · 0 评论 -
WebSphere Commerce Engerprise - enableFeature
IBM Bug Oracle默认端口是50000,更改oralce端口密码1521。所有版本都应该是 7.0.0.11。原创 2025-04-04 09:30:00 · 493 阅读 · 0 评论 -
Start IBMIHS and AppServer
IHS管理控制台Password:原创 2025-04-05 08:00:00 · 663 阅读 · 0 评论 -
WebSphere Commerce Engerprise - Initialization store
ExtendedSites-FEP.sarMadisonsEnhancements.sar原创 2025-04-06 08:30:00 · 221 阅读 · 0 评论 -
WebSphere Commerce Engerprise
我使用英文UTF-8,如需更改使用下面命令。安装依赖软件,后Back在Next一次。创建一个非root用户。原创 2025-04-02 18:32:30 · 1018 阅读 · 0 评论 -
WebSphere Commerce Engerprise 7.0 Feature Pack 2.iso
# unzip download.updii.7002.linux.amd64.zip# UpdateInstaller/install# cp 7.0.0-WS-WCServer-FP002.pak /opt/IBM/WebSphere/UpdateInstaller1/maintenance/原创 2025-04-03 09:30:00 · 382 阅读 · 0 评论 -
UpdateInstaller (AppServer, Plugins, IBMIHS)
# tar zxvf 7.0.0.11-ws-updi-linuxamd64.tar.gz# UpdateInstaller/install# cp *.pak /opt/IBM/WebSphere/UpdateInstaller/maintenance/原创 2025-04-02 18:34:30 · 198 阅读 · 0 评论 -
WebSphere Commerce Engerprise - WAS 安装配置
/opt/IBM/WebSphere/UpdateInstaller/update.sh原创 2025-04-02 18:36:48 · 317 阅读 · 0 评论 -
WebSphere Commerce Engerprise - Plugins
/opt/IBM/WebSphere/UpdateInstaller/update.sh原创 2025-04-03 09:00:00 · 133 阅读 · 0 评论 -
Linux 字符串截取命令 cut
截取第 8 个字符8从第五个字符开始,截取后面的567890截取第8个字符前面的字符串12345678从第4字符开始,截取至第8个字符为止45678每一行操作,截取位置1-4的字符rootdaembin:sys:syncgameman:suchNo suchNo such。原创 2025-04-05 15:02:52 · 587 阅读 · 0 评论 -
Kamailio SIP 服务器 RPM 包安装
这里环境是阿里云,阿里云有一个公网IP地址影射到内网的 eth0 上,所以我们必须配置 kamailio 告诉他公网地址是什么。192.168.0.71 是内网 eth0 的 LAN IP 地址,139.9.54.21 是 WAN IP 地址。备份配置文件,防止修改损坏。启动 kamailio。原创 2025-03-30 23:42:31 · 880 阅读 · 0 评论 -
Kamailio SIP 服务器,用户管理
原创 2025-03-31 10:26:04 · 610 阅读 · 0 评论 -
RTPProxy 编译安装
log_facility为日志输出到哪,利用的系统日志。-s 本机侦听opensips通知端口。log_level为日志级别,值如下。-F 不检查是否为超级用户模式。-l 本机内网侦听地址。-n 超时通知接收端口。-d 调试消息输出级别。-m rtp最小端口。-M rtp最大端口。原创 2025-03-31 16:09:33 · 545 阅读 · 0 评论 -
Kamailio SIP Server + MySQL + Rocky Linux
启动 rtpproxy,参数 rtpproxy -A 公网地址 -l 本地地址 -s udp:127.0.0.1:7722 -m 最小起始端口 -M 最大终止端口号 -F。安装 mysql 模块。配置 kamailio。添加用户(分机号码)原创 2025-03-30 23:45:28 · 463 阅读 · 0 评论 -
Kamailio SIP 服务器 DBTEXT 文本数据库配置
kamailio 可以使用多种数据库 MYSQL, PGSQL, ORACLE, DB_BERKELEY, DBTEXT, or SQLITE 存储用户信息,这里使用最简单的纯文本文件,存储用户数据原创 2025-03-31 10:24:00 · 1263 阅读 · 0 评论 -
YOLO 标签工具 2025-3-17版本
该工具会持续更新,请关注博主,获取最新版本。原创 2025-03-17 16:59:06 · 484 阅读 · 0 评论 -
YOLO 标签修改工具
【代码】YOLO 标签修改工具。原创 2025-03-08 08:22:29 · 498 阅读 · 0 评论 -
Docker Example
此时 6670 父进程已经完成配置的更新,6671~6674 也完成了它的使命,下一次新用户过来 nginx 就会创建新的进程,这个过程是无缝的,用户感知不到,80/443 端口始终提供服务,不会有任何用户出现中断链接的情况。6670 父进程可以接收操作系统传递过来的信号(不懂信号的同学请恶补,信号,共享内存,管道,Socket 可以实现进程间通信),也就是我们可以告诉正在运行的进程,现在要干什么。上面不能满足生产环境的需求,通常不会将数据放在容器中,我的做法如下。启动 spring boot 容器。原创 2024-10-10 08:15:00 · 920 阅读 · 0 评论 -
Docker FAQ
已知 IP 172.17.0.66 我们希望知道那个容器在使用该 IP 地址。原创 2024-10-10 08:30:00 · 1330 阅读 · 0 评论 -
使用 Dockerfile 制作镜像
因为官方提供的镜像无法满足我们的需求,例如 nginx 镜像你会发现 ps, top 等等很多命令缺失。工作中我们常常发现官方镜像裁剪的面目全非,里面缺失很多常用工具,这种情况给我们工作带来诸多不便。ENTRYPOINT docker-entrypoint.sh 会使用 sh -c 执行。所以需要写成 ENTRYPOINT ["docker-entrypoint.sh"]EXPOSE 是声明端口,容器内运行的程序使用了什么端口。运行镜像,看看这个镜像,在里面模拟一次执行。进入容器,修改apk库的镜像。原创 2024-10-11 10:00:27 · 1017 阅读 · 0 评论 -
docker-compose.yml 容器编排
本章节介绍如何定义 docker-compose.yml 文件首先创建项目目录 mkdir dockercd dockervim docker-compose.yml 2.13.1. 版本号 version: '3.8' 2.13.2. 镜像image: mysql:5.7 表示使用 mysql:5.7 镜像, image: mysql:latest 表示 mysql 最新版 services: db: image: mysql原创 2024-10-11 10:01:36 · 612 阅读 · 0 评论 -
Xen 虚拟机安装与配置
ubuntuliststartrebootshutdownconsoleconfigvcpus = 1。原创 2024-10-14 08:15:00 · 915 阅读 · 0 评论 -
OpenVZ 虚拟机安装与配置
解决方法:进入/etc/sysconfig/vz-scripts/目录,将ve.basic.conf-sample 拷贝一份重命名为ve-vps.basic.conf-sample。该命令将建立centos-4-i386-minimal.tar.gz和centos-4-i386-default.tar.gz文件 或。net.ipv4.conf.default.send_redirects = 1 #添加。net.ipv4.conf.default.proxy_arp = 0 #添加。原创 2024-10-14 08:30:00 · 1291 阅读 · 0 评论 -
Helm 安装与配置
初始化本地,并将 Tiller 安装到 Kubernetes cluster。# 删除 mysql 并释放该名字以便后续使用。# 更新本地 charts repo。homebrew 安装 Helm。# 安装 mysql chart。# 删除 mysql。原创 2024-10-15 05:41:22 · 667 阅读 · 0 评论 -
Helm 命令用法举例
在stable仓库搜索 redis应用。查看当前的 Charts 包仓库。查看包详细信息与帮助手册。原创 2024-10-15 05:45:30 · 610 阅读 · 0 评论 -
使用 netkiller-devops 优雅地编排 Docker 容器
使用 save 可以保存为 yaml 文件,这是使用 docker-compose -f development.yaml up 就可以启动容器了。docker compose 是 docker 的容器编排工具,它是基于 YAML 配置,YAML 是一种配置文件格式,支持传递环境变量,但是对于复杂的容器编排显得力不从心。Docker 对象是让我们摆脱 docker-compose 这个命令,它将接管 docker-compose 这个命令,进行自我管理。compose.start() 启动已存在的容器。原创 2024-10-15 06:10:16 · 1420 阅读 · 0 评论 -
Rancher 安装与配置(一)
浏览器输入 https://your-ip-address 即可进入WebUI。Rancher Compose是一个多主机版本的Docker Compose。仅用 unsupported-storage-drivers。配置 rke2-agent 服务。安装 cert-manager。安装完之后运行下面命令查看密码。如果只是学习,可以安装最新版。安装用于生产环境的稳定版。防火墙放行 etcd。原创 2024-10-16 08:00:00 · 1952 阅读 · 0 评论 -
Rancher 安装与配置(二) Compose
-file, -f [–file option –file option] 指定一个compose 文件 (默认: docker-compose.yml) [$COMPOSE_FILE]--rancher-file, -r 指定一个 Rancher Compose 文件 (默认: rancher-compose.yml)--access-key 指定 Rancher API access key [$RANCHER_ACCESS_KEY]--env-file, -e 指定一个环境变量配置文件。原创 2024-10-16 08:15:00 · 984 阅读 · 0 评论 -
Rancher 安装配置(三)命令常用用法
链接到 Rancher。原创 2024-10-16 08:30:00 · 773 阅读 · 0 评论 -
Rancher 安装与配置(四)autok3s
将 1TB 硬盘挂载到 /var/lib/rancher/k3s/storage,另一种方案,由于1TB硬盘已经在使用,并且挂载到了 /opt 目录,这时我们使用 --volumes '/opt/kubernetes:/var/lib/rancher/k3s/storage' 将 /var/lib/rancher/k3s/storage 挂载到 /opt/kubernetes 目录。autok3s/k3s/k3d 三种封装,安装最简单的是 autok3s,其次是 k3d,如果喜欢蒸腾就安装原生 k3s。原创 2024-10-17 08:00:00 · 1040 阅读 · 0 评论 -
Kubernetes 分布式存储 Longhorn
field.cattle.io/description: 硬盘存储。选择多个标签 diskSelector: "ssd,fast"由于我不需要 NFS 所以没有安装 nfs-utils。/opt/longhorn/ 被打了 HDD 标签。首先要给磁盘打上标签,才能使用这个功能。原创 2024-10-17 08:15:00 · 959 阅读 · 0 评论 -
演示 Rancher 部署 Nginx
准备编排脚本metadata:labels:app: nginxspec:ports:- port: 88selector:app: nginx---metadata:labels:app: nginxspec:selector:app: nginxtemplate:metadata:labels:app: nginxspec:ports:部署查看状态。原创 2024-10-17 08:38:04 · 1282 阅读 · 0 评论 -
如何从 docker 过渡到 kubectl 命令
如果之前用其他方式运行Kubernetes,如 minikube, mircok8s 等等,可以使用下面命令切换。将本地 0.0.0.0:27017 端口转发到 service 端口。查看 ingress.spec 配置清单。docker exec 命令。docker run 命令。docker ps 命令。kubectl 命令。kubectl 命令。kubectl 命令。原创 2024-10-19 07:31:52 · 956 阅读 · 0 评论 -
Linux VoIP Server Asterisk
exten => 10010,1,Dial(PJSIP/1111) /*当拨打10010时转到分机1111中*/exten => 10086,1,Dial(PJSIP/6666) /*当拨打10086时转到分机6666中*/exten => 110,1,Answer() /*当拨打110时自动接听*/原创 2025-03-09 12:28:21 · 521 阅读 · 0 评论